CII-SAP to equip MSMEs with digital technologies for global markets

Opportunities to access 240+ courses through Code Unnati

The CII has formed a partnership with SAP to equip over 6,400 MSME direct members and over 2 lakh indirect membership from 298 national and regional sectoral industry bodies with digital technologies that will further them to create demand for their products and transact globally.

With the Global Bharat Program, CII members can access the SAP Ariba Discovery network, register themselves as suppliers for free, get sales enquiries and sell their products worldwide.

Additionally, CII members will also digitally upskill their workforce through SAP India’s Code Unnati by accessing more than 240 courses on Digital Financial, Soft Skills, Productivity Technologies etc.

These will be available through an application for people to access via their android smartphone devices, helping them adapt to the new working environments.

“The pandemic has affected the way businesses used to function, pushing organizations to adopt and rely on technology to stay relevant in the market. Our purpose of collaborating with SAP and bringing in the Global Bharat program for our members is to help them to the best of our ability in finding a solid footing during these unprecedented times,” said

Shreekant Somany, Chairman, CII National MSME Council.

“We truly believe that this initiative will help our Indian MSMEs to transform themselves digitally and empower them to take their business to the global level,” said Somany.

“When we launched the Global Bharat program back in June 2020, we set an objective to help Indian MSMEs become globally competitive by enabling them with digital tools and solutions,” added Subramanian Ananthapadmanabhan, Vice President and Head of General Business, SAP Indian Subcontinent.

“We are excited that CII shares our vision to help Indian MSMEs seize this opportunity and emerge from this crisis stronger and more resilient than ever,” he said on 6 Nov 2020 at the announcement of CII-SAP partnership.
